Microcontrollers are hidden inside a surprising number of products these days. If your microwave oven has an LED or LCD display screen and a keypad, it accommodates a microcontroller. All fashionable cars comprise no less than one microcontroller, and might have as many as six or seven: The engine is managed by a microcontroller, as are the anti-lock brakes, the cruise management and so forth. Any system that has a distant control nearly actually accommodates a microcontroller: TVs, VCRs and excessive-end stereo methods all fall into this category. You get the concept. Basically, any product or machine that interacts with its person has a microcontroller buried inside. In the process, you'll study an awful lot about how microcontrollers are used in commercial merchandise. What's a Microcontroller? A microcontroller is a pc. All computer systems have a CPU (central processing unit) that executes applications. In case you are sitting at a desktop pc proper now studying this text, the CPU in that machine is executing a program that implements the net browser that's displaying this page. The CPU loads the program from someplace. On your desktop machine, the browser program is loaded from the exhausting disk. And the pc has some enter and output gadgets so it might probably speak to individuals. On your desktop machine, the keyboard and Memory Wave mouse are enter units and the monitor and printer are output gadgets. A tough disk is an I/O gadget -- it handles both enter and output. The desktop laptop you might be using is a "general objective laptop" that may run any of 1000's of applications.


Microcontrollers are "particular objective computers." Microcontrollers do one thing well. There are quite a few different common traits that outline microcontrollers. Microcontrollers are devoted to 1 job and run one particular program. This system is stored in ROM (learn-only memory) and usually does not change. Microcontrollers are sometimes low-energy devices. A desktop pc is nearly always plugged into a wall socket and may devour 50 watts of electricity. A battery-operated microcontroller would possibly consume 50 milliwatts. A microcontroller has a devoted input gadget and infrequently (however not at all times) has a small LED or LCD show for output. A microcontroller also takes enter from the gadget it is controlling and controls the system by sending signals to completely different parts in the gadget. For example, the microcontroller inside a Television takes input from the distant control and displays output on the Tv display. The controller controls the channel selector, the speaker system and certain changes on the image tube electronics such as tint and brightness.


The engine controller in a automobile takes input from sensors such as the oxygen and knock sensors and controls things like fuel mix and spark plug timing. A microwave oven controller takes input from a keypad, displays output on an LCD show and controls a relay that turns the microwave generator on and off. A microcontroller is commonly small and low value. The elements are chosen to attenuate size and to be as inexpensive as potential. A microcontroller is commonly, but not always, ruggedized ultimately. The microcontroller controlling a automobile's engine, for example, has to work in temperature extremes that a normal pc typically cannot handle. A automotive's microcontroller in Alaska has to work superb in -30 diploma F (-34 C) weather, whereas the same microcontroller in Nevada might be working at one hundred twenty degrees F (forty nine C). When you add the heat naturally generated by the engine, the temperature can go as excessive as one hundred fifty or 180 degrees F (65-eighty C) in the engine compartment.
